UpgradeNanette is a highly experienced and qualified Upper Limb Extended Scope Physiotherapist, with over 20 years of experience working in the NHS. She is specialised in providing a high level of expertise in the management of routine and complex upper limb musculoskeletal conditions.
She has completed a BSc (with Honours) in Physiotherapy in 2002, then Master's Degree in Advancing Physiotherapy in 2015. She is registered under the HCPC, a member of the Chartered Society of Physiotherapy and an active member of the British Elbow and Shoulder Society.
Nanette was awarded the British Elbow and Shoulder Society’s travelling fellowship in 2015 which gave her the opportunity to visit the Mayo clinic in the USA and leading London hospitals.
She has a special interest in the assessment and management of shoulder instability (both structural and non-structural) in both adults and children, and has spoken locally, regionally and nationally on the subject. She has also contributed to research papers and co-authored a chapter in a published Textbook on the shoulder and elbow.
Alongside her part time MSK work, based primarily at Chesterfield Royal Hospital in Derbyshire, Nanette is also clinical Team Lead for the First Contact Practitioner service in Sheffield and is Shoulder and elbow Clinical Lead for the White House Physiotherapy Team, affiliated with Physio Net.
